Edward Lany
Edward Lany, FRS was List of Masters of [Pembroke College, Cambridge|Master of Pembroke College, Cambridge] from 1707 until his death.
Lany entered Pembroke College, Cambridge in 1709. He graduated B.A. in 1687, M.A. in 1690 and D.D. in 1707. He became a Fellow of Pembroke in 1688, and was ordained in 1689. He held livings at Salle and Chrishall; and was a Chaplain to William III. He was also Vice-Chancellor of the University of Cambridge from 1707 to 1708.
Lany died on 9 August 1728.
